On Location: Stars, glamour & maritime traditions at MSC World America christening
Drew Barrymore and Orlando Bloom aboard MSC World America. (Pax Global Media)

MSC Cruises is going all out for the launch of its new flagship, the MSC World America.

On April 9, the company christened the ship at a ceremony held at its new, state-of-the-art cruise terminal in Miami. PAX was on location to witness the momentous occasion.

During the ceremony, MSC World America's godmother, actress and TV host Drew Barrymore, cut the ribbon, triggering the breaking of the bottle on the ship's bow—a gesture rooted in time-honoured maritime traditions intended to wish the ship good fortune.

The actress was joined by actor Orlando Bloom, her partner in MSC Cruises' "Let's Holiday" campaign, launched to coincide with the Super Bowl.

“It’s a tremendous honour to be the patron of MSC World America. I’ve always been passionate about travel. It’s always allowed me to recharge my batteries and have amazing experiences,” said Barrymore.

“Over time, this beautiful new ship will allow millions of people to experience unforgettable moments, and I’m sure they’ll be amazed by everything MSC World America has to offer.”

Following the event, MSC World America embarked on an inaugural three-night cruise to Ocean Cay MSC Marine Reserve, the company's private island in the Bahamas.

Guests also had the opportunity to attend a gala dinner and enjoy exclusive performances, including one by Gloria Estefan. During the christening ceremony, they also got a sneak peek at Dirty Dancing the concert 

The show takes the beloved film to the next level with live singers, dancers and musicians, bringing the screening of the iconic movie to life.

In addition to getting a sneak peek at the MSC World America's amenities and services, guests were able to explore Ocean Cay MSC Marine Reserve.

The island houses a marine conservation center, which will serve as a base for researchers and students involved in the "Super Coral" program, which aims to restore coral reefs damaged by climate change. MSC World America passengers were able to learn more about this ecological initiative.

A new chapter in cruising

MSC says its new, ultramodern ship, the second in MSC Cruises' World Class, heralds a new chapter in the world of cruising.

MSC World America has 19 cabin types, from luxurious suites to family-friendly connecting cabins, balcony cabins, to affordable interior options

The new ship aims to introduce a “a new world of cruising” with re-imagined venues and concepts tailored specifically to the U.S. market, such as a new sports bar and comedy club concepts.

MSC World America debuts two new lounge concepts – All-Stars Sports Bar, offering a game-day atmosphere with all-American fare and bar games, and The Loft, a multi-purpose venue for comedy, karaoke and more.

The drink menus have also been Americanized with more bourbons, U.S.-style beers and gin from craft American distilleries, says MSC.

Also new is The Loft, an adults-only venue for comedy shows, duelling pianos and classic karaoke nights.

Another venue is Elixir, a mixology bar, which serves handcrafted beverages with refreshing Fever Tree mixers and fresh ingredients.

Introduced aboard MSC World Europa, Elixir comes with a new focus on bourbon and bourbon-based cocktails—alongside an array of other spirits.

Masters of the Seas is a British-style pub will be at the heart of MSC World America’s Terraces district with a lively and warm atmosphere for enjoying live music and drinks.

The pub features MSC's second full-scale micro-brewery at sea, offering a newly-developed range of signature beers from brew master Teo Musso of Baladin Brewery—an American-style lite beer, IPA and Pilsner—that are made from desalinated sea water.

The Gin Project, meanwhile, has 20 craft gins—sourced with a focus on American and Canadian craft gin distilleries complimented by a curated selection of international favourites and a menu of classic botanical cocktails prepared by gin-tenders in the Terraces district.

The enhanced Sweet Temptations, which debuted on MSC World Europa, comes to MSC World America with a new look and more selection of confectionary wonders, like self-serve frozen yogurt bar, make-your-own ice cream bars, hot crepes and waffles, donuts, and candies.

It also has the only Eataly restaurant at sea. 

MSC World America will sail its inaugural season in the Caribbean, departing from PortMiami. Each itinerary will include a stopover at Ocean Cay MSC Marine Reserve.
